had a scare in December.  I had blood in my (diarrhea) stool for about 3 weeks. I talked to my boss (Dr. who is also a surgeon) & he told me to talk to Dr. Husted.   Dr.  Husted didn't think it had anything to do with my DS, but wanted me to see a Gastroenterologist to be sure.  I told my boss, who called the Gastro & told him about my DS (Gastro was well informed & knew difference between DS & RNY!!!).  Anyway I had to get an endoscopy & colonoscopy! YUCK!  Anyway, I have been taking 800mg Ibuprofen 3x per day for my back pain - I have bleeding ulcers in my stomach - not on my scar line (which is apparently healed beautifully & the gastro said Husted did a perfect job!), inflammation in my stomach AND a polyp in my colon (he removed & it was benign), & microscopic colitis (inflammation in my colon) from the stupid ibuprofen use over the last 18 months! I am glad it's not surgery related, but I have to go through finding pain meds that work & don't inflame my intestines!  Apparently it has nothing to do with my DS!  

I also learned that I have my own kind of "dumping syndrome".  If I eat something I shouldn't, such as Ice Cream or crackers, I get really bad cramps & feel terrible for about 2 hours, until after it works its way through my digestive system.  I guess I know to avoid these things, unless I want to feel like shit!
